Ingredients

Before we start, make sure you have all the ingredients listed below:
  • 350g plain flour
  • 1 tsp bicarbonate of soda
  • 2 tsp ground ginger
  • 1 tsp ground cinnamon
  • 125g unsalted butter
  • 175g light brown sugar
  • 1 egg
  • 4 tbsp golden syrup
  • Assorted candies for decorating (optional)

Instructions

Now that you have all the ingredients, let's start making the gingerbread house.

Step 1: Making the Dough

1. Preheat your oven to 180°C (160°C fan)/350°F/gas mark 4. 2. In a large bowl, mix together the flour, bicarbonate of soda, ginger, and cinnamon. 3. In a separate bowl, cream the butter and sugar together until light and fluffy. 4. Beat in the egg and golden syrup. 5. Gradually add the dry ingredients to the wet mixture, mixing well until a dough forms. 6. Wrap the dough in cling film and chill for at least 30 minutes.

Step 2: Cutting and Baking the Gingerbread

1. Line a baking tray with parchment paper. 2. Roll out the dough on a floured surface to a thickness of around 0.5cm/0.25in. 3. Using a knife or cookie cutter, cut out the shapes for your gingerbread house (two walls, two roof pieces, and two chimney pieces). 4. Place the shapes on the prepared baking tray and bake for 10-12 minutes or until lightly golden. 5. Remove from the oven and leave to cool on the tray for 5 minutes before transferring to a wire rack to cool completely.

Step 3: Assembling the Gingerbread House

1. Once the gingerbread has cooled completely, it's time to assemble the house. 2. Use a thick icing made from icing sugar and water to “glue” the walls and roof together. 3. Leave the icing to dry and harden for at least an hour before adding the chimney and any other decorations. 4. If you want to add candies or other decorations to your gingerbread house, use the icing as glue to attach them to the house.
